  32. <b>STRENGTHS:</b>
  33.  
  34. ☆ <b>Confident</b> - Karamatsu is a person who oozes confidence...or he'd like you to think that he does. He's never shy and never really hesitates to speak his mind in a situation, even when he's usually overlooked or ignored entirely when he's talking. He will act however he pleases, dress however he wants, and say what he's thinking at any given moment regardless of the way it might be perceived...and received.
  35.  
  36. ☆ <b>Genuine</b> - If there's one thing you can say about Karamatsu, it's that you can almost always trust that what comes out of his mouth is at least probably the truth. A lot this ties into his tendency to speak his mind. He has very little filter sometimes, and often will just say things that he honestly thinks without realizing that they might be taken badly. For example, he once very frankly tells Choromatsu that he thinks his face looks weird, then gets confused when Choromatsu rightfully yells at him for it, as if he doesn't understand why he's being yelled at. He <i>genuinely</i> didn't mean to upset him, but also meant what he said when he said it.
  37.  
  38. ☆ <b>Passionate</b> - When Karamatsu does something, he does it at 110%. Of course, this isn't to say the things he does are necessarily ever <i>productive</i>...but when it comes to writing his own music or designing his own clothes, he goes as hard and as eagerly into it as he possibly can. He has a very high appreciation for nature and all things beautiful in the world, and will frequently bring these sorts of things up in conversation. Even in episode 24 when the brothers split up and leave home, Karamatsu surprisingly gets very serious about finding a place to live. Once he's sharing an apartment with friend of the family Chibita, he spends night after night writing resumes and going to job interviews, only to be rejected to start the cycle all over again. Not even once does he give up, not until he and his brothers get back together again the following episode.
  39.  
  40. ☆ <b>Kind</b> - In contrast to the rest of his siblings, Karamatsu is arguably one of the most compassionate. Perhaps this is due to the way he is treated daily and his desire to be accepted by his brothers, but regardless he's very often bending over backwards to help them out. This extends beyond his family as well, and is the most prevalent when he very briefly finds himself a girlfriend (who is...terrible. More on that in weaknesses) and spends literally all of his time tending to her needs, getting her things, and pretty much waiting on her hand and foot.

  46. <br /><br /><b>Skills & abilities:</b> OKAY SO. Karamatsu doesn't exactly have many talents or things going for him. None of his siblings do, really, it's half the reason they're NEETs in the first place. Karamatsu does claim to be a musician and can play decently well, and he dabbles in arts and crafts (except that everything he makes is hard to look at), but those things all pale in comparison to what truly makes Karamatsu <i>Karamatsu</i>.
  47.  
  48. Karamatsu's main character trait is that he is <i>painful</i>. Not literally painful, but he causes people pain by being utterly embarrassing. He speaks with very forced language at times, using words that are overly flowery and poetic like he's putting on a play for some invisible audience. It's never expected when he'll start doing this, but when he does you can bet that it's going to be nonsensical and not about to stop any time soon. Every time he opens his mouth his brothers just flat out ignore him to avoid it.
